The Air Max 90 has been celebrating its 30-year-anniversary in 2020, and Nike has been offering up plenty of new and classic styles in its honor. This week, the vintage trainer is back with a new take on the iconic infrared colorway, available now.
The ‘Infrared’ Nike Air Max 90 has been heralded as one of the greatest sneakers of all time and attributed with helping grow the world of sneakers and collecting on a massive scale. With the anniversary of the classic silhouette being celebrated this year, it’s a little surprising that Nike has waited so long to release it (dropping on November 9th). However, in addition to the standard fan-favorite version, another strikingly similar Quickstrike release has surfaced at retailers overseas as well. The new version rebuilds the Air Max 90’s upper entirely from smooth suede, which is embossed to give it a wavy, ripple-effect pattern throughout. From the base to outer overlays, each layer comes in a soft grey tone, while “Bright Crimson” TPU makes up the lace eyelets, Air Max branding, heel counters, and midsole inserts.
